Paola Di Leo is a scholar working on Geophysics, Atmospheric Science and Biomaterials. According to data from OpenAlex, Paola Di Leo has authored 31 papers receiving a total of 630 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Geophysics, 8 papers in Atmospheric Science and 8 papers in Biomaterials. Recurrent topics in Paola Di Leo’s work include Geological and Geochemical Analysis (9 papers), earthquake and tectonic studies (8 papers) and Geology and Paleoclimatology Research (8 papers). Paola Di Leo is often cited by papers focused on Geological and Geochemical Analysis (9 papers), earthquake and tectonic studies (8 papers) and Geology and Paleoclimatology Research (8 papers). Paola Di Leo collaborates with scholars based in Italy, United States and United Kingdom. Paola Di Leo's co-authors include Marcello Schiattarella, Salvatore Ivo Giano, Maria Pizzigallo, Sveva Corrado, Massimiliano Zattin, Chiara Invernizzi, Valeria Ancona, Luca Aldega, Stefano Mazzoli and Emanuela Schingaro and has published in prestigious journals such as Journal of Hazardous Materials, Chemosphere and Marine Pollution Bulletin.
